... From the late 18th century to the early 19th century, some people began to stand up against this inhuman treatment of the mentally ill. Examples include the Quaker merchant Tuke, who created an ideal facility called York Retreat in York, England; the aforementioned Lisle, who advocated reform of the asylums, saying that "only mental treatment can directly cure the insane," and the German doctor J. G. Langermann, who rebuilt a facility near Bayreuth into a model psychiatric hospital and lived with the sick. The most well-known example is the French physician P. Pinel, who freed patients from iron chains at the Bicetre Hospital near Paris on August 25, 1793, as the revolution was progressing. ... *Some of the terminology that mentions "Langermann, JG" is listed below.
